Calcium signaling and pathogenesis of dysferlin C2 domains

open access: yes, 2020
Failure to repair injured sarcolemmal membranes leads to muscular dystrophy, a degenerative disorder that results in increasing weakness and gradual wasting of skeletal muscles. Mutations in the gene encoding dysferlin are causative for limb girdle muscular dystrophy type 2B (LGMD2B) and Miyoshi myopathy (MM) forms of the disease.
